Recognizing Warm Pumps: Just How They Function and Their Benefits
While several homeowners take into consideration different heating alternatives, understanding exactly how heat pumps feature and their benefits can substantially influence their choice. Heatpump run by moving heat as opposed to producing it. In the winter season, they remove warmth from the outdoors air or ground and transfer it indoors, while in the summertime, they reverse this process, cooling down the home by removing warm outside. This dual functionality makes them functional for year-round environment control.One of the primary benefits of warmth pumps is their power performance. They make use of considerably less power compared to traditional heater, potentially resulting in reduced utility bills (heat pump installation ooltewah tn). In addition, heatpump have a smaller carbon footprint, making them an eco-friendly option. They additionally require less maintenance than standard systems, contributing to long-lasting expense savings. Overall, understanding the mechanics and advantages of heat pumps can help property owners make notified choices concerning their home heating and cooling down needs

Kinds of Heating systems
Furnace can differ substantially in design and procedure, with heaters being a popular option amongst home owners. There are a number of sorts of furnaces, each making use of different gas resources and innovations. Gas heaters are typical, leveraging natural gas to generate warm efficiently. Electric heaters, on the other hand, make use of electric resistance to generate warmth, usually preferred for their uncomplicated setup. Oil heaters, while much less usual, are effective in areas with restricted gas access (heat pump installation ooltewah tn). Furthermore, condensing heating systems optimize energy effectiveness by catching and reusing exhaust gases. Each kind operates with a system of heat exchangers and ductwork to disperse warm air throughout a home. Understanding the differences in between these furnace kinds is essential for notified HVAC decisions

Seasonal Energy Efficiency Ratio
Energy effectiveness plays a crucial role in the decision-making process between heat pumps and furnaces, especially when thinking about the Seasonal Energy Effectiveness Ratio (SEER) This metric procedures the cooling performance of warmth pumps over a whole air conditioning period, supplying a standard method to examine efficiency. Higher SEER ratings indicate higher energy performance, converting to lower energy consumption and minimized utility expenses. In comparison, heating systems are generally evaluated using the Annual Gas Application Performance (AFUE) ranking, which shows home heating performance. When comparing these two systems, homeowners must focus on SEER rankings for warm pumps, as they directly impact total power cost savings and ecological sustainability. A thorough understanding of SEER can especially affect the long-lasting complete satisfaction and cost-effectiveness of the picked a/c option.

Installment Prices: What to Anticipate for Each Furnace
Installment expenses for furnace can vary significantly between heatpump and heaters, affecting homeowners' decisions. Heat pumps normally have greater ahead of time installation prices, generally ranging from $3,500 to $8,000, depending upon the unit size and complexity of installation. This consists of the exterior device, interior handling system, and essential ductwork alterations. Alternatively, heaters often tend to have reduced preliminary expenses, averaging between $2,500 and $6,000, which can be appealing for budget-conscious homeowners. However, installation expenditures can raise if considerable ductwork is required.Moreover, the selection of gas type for furnaces-- gas, gas, or electrical-- can likewise impact installment expenses. While warmth pumps use energy efficiency, their first financial investment may hinder some purchasers. Ultimately, reviewing installment prices alongside long-lasting savings and effectiveness will certainly help property owners in making notified decisions regarding their home heating systems.
Environment Factors To Consider: Which System Does Better in Your Location
How do climate problems influence the performance of furnace? The efficiency of warm pumps and heaters can differ greatly depending on the local climate. In moderate climates, heat pumps excel by successfully moving warmth from the outside air, making them an energy-saving choice. Nevertheless, their efficiency reduces in very chilly temperatures, where they may struggle to draw out sufficient warmth. On the other hand, heating systems, especially gas versions, give regular and trusted heat no matter of exterior problems, making them better in colder regions.In locations that experience milder winters, heatpump can run properly year-round, giving both cooling and heating. In contrast, areas with harsh winter seasons commonly take advantage of the toughness of heaters. Eventually, understanding the local environment is important when making a decision in between a heat pump and a heater, as it straight influences their operational performance and overall performance.
Maintenance Needs: Long-Term Look After Heat Pumps vs. Furnaces
While both heat pumps and heating systems need routine upkeep to assure peak efficiency, their specific demands and care regimens differ substantially. Heaters generally need much less regular attention, with annual assessments sufficing to look for gas leaks, tidy filters, and assess general performance. Their easier design often enables simple repairs.In comparison, heatpump demand biannual maintenance as a result of their twin function in cooling and heating. This consists of cleaning coils, examining refrigerant levels, and ensuring that both the outdoor and indoor systems function at their ideal. Furthermore, warm pump upkeep usually entails even more elaborate elements, making professional maintenance essential.Neglecting maintenance can cause lessened efficiency and enhanced power costs for both systems. Eventually, home owners should think about these long-lasting treatment demands when picking in between a heatpump and a furnace, as positive upkeep can extend the life expectancy discover this and performance of either system considerably.

Just How Lengthy Do Heat Pumps and Furnaces Normally Last?
The life expectancy of heat pumps generally ranges from 15 to twenty years, while heaters can last between 15 to three decades. Normal maintenance considerably impacts their long life and efficiency in providing home heating services.
Can I Make Use Of a Heatpump in Very Cold Climates?
Heatpump can operate in exceptionally cool environments, but their efficiency decreases as temperature levels decrease. In such problems, extra home heating sources might be essential to keep comfy interior temperatures and guarantee peak efficiency.

What Is the Sound Level of Heat Pumps Versus Furnaces?
The sound levels of warm pumps and heaters differ substantially. Usually, warmth pumps run even more quietly than conventional heating systems, making them more suitable for those sensitive to appear, while heating systems might create louder functional noises throughout home heating cycles.
Are Heat Pumps Suitable for Both Cooling And Heating?
Heatpump are certainly ideal for both heating & cooling (furnace replacement). They work by transferring warmth, giving efficient temperature control year-round, making them a versatile selection for property owners looking for an all-in-one cooling and heating remedy
